Mines in Wyandot County, Ohio
Wyandot County, Ohio has 14 mines on MSHA's register: 5 active, 1 intermittent, 7 abandoned. 1 miner has died and 425 accidents have been reported at these mines between 1983 and 2026. Inspectors have issued 915 citations.

Status, type and operator are as reported to MSHA. Fatality and accident counts are MSHA's reportable accident records for the mine; citations are inspector-issued violations on record. Each mine's own page carries the full detail.
The register is MSHA's Mine Data Retrieval System: every operation ever assigned a mine ID, including ones abandoned decades ago, so the count is a history of mining in the county, not a count of working mines. A mine's county is the one its operator reported to MSHA. Fatality and accident counts start with MSHA's reportable-accident records (1983 onward); citation counts are inspector-issued violations on record. We are an independent research tool, not MSHA.
